My philosophy towards web site design is to keep the look clean and the navigation simple and easy to use, which I feel is reflected in my work. All my code is written by hand in TextPad, this ensures that I learn what the code does, and I do not reley on a WYSISYG editor to produce the code and layouts. All my sites are tested in Internet Explorer (6 and 7), Firefox 2, Opera 9 and Safari. I also include basic SEO (keywords in text, headings and meta tags).

Thumbnail image of the Vintage Classics web site Vintage Classics designed and built for a local company that specialise in Vintage car hire and chauffeur driven Classic car hire. The site uses XHTML (Transitional), CSS, PHP, a small amount of java script (for menu functionality) and some graphic work using Photoshop. The SEO for this site rates very high in Google for serches on "vintage car hire" and "classic car hire", whch was one of the goals of the customer, which for the customer was very important as he operates in a highly competative market.

Thumbnail image of the Below The Salt web site Below The Salt An e-commerce website built and designed for a local business that sells "Folk" orientated merchandise. The site uses HTML, CSS, javascript plus integration with PayPal to enable online sales and ordering. The use of PayPal is an excellant way for a small business to do "on line" selling. I feel it inspires confidence for the buyer. Another project which required understanding of the customers requirements, plus I have also passed on my knowledge so that the customer can update the site by himself.
